Fear & Loathing in E-Street
Lisa apologises to Sonny about before and they discuss seeing their mother. Lisa decides to write an article about prisoners and illiteracy with Kim approves of. Meanwhile at the pub, an old man whom everyone believes is a drunk, gets sick and it is eventually revelaed he has a form of Asbestos poisoning from his days at working at a factory. Kim feels slightly guilty of her ignorance but vows to follow up the mans life after he dies when he eventually gets to hospital. After a few misunderstandings, Abbey & Ernie make up after he tells her. She vows war on Vi who had, of course engineered her false thoughts. On camp, Chris wakes up unable to move and after an hour of running about, Megan realises that Chris is in danger as she had just thought he was being a sleephead. They form a team and eventually he is saved and she kills (the rather fake) snake. Bob tries one last time to woo Elly but she doesn't notice him as they are interrupted by David once again.
